What is a bright fish lamp?
To make a fish lamp, first tie a bamboo stick into a fish-shaped skeleton, and then dye the fish scales and fins with gauze. The master makes the meaning vivid and lights the candles, which are transparent, colorful and lifelike. Fish lanterns are six or seven feet to more than ten feet long and are supported by pillars when patrolling. Two more people are needed to support the headlights.
Fish lantern dance is a group dance in the square created by Shunde folk to celebrate the harvest of fishery. Fish Lantern Festival is a mass entertainment custom for fishermen to celebrate festivals, ancestors and harvest.
Shunde Daliang Fish Lantern Festival has a long history. From the mid-Qing Dynasty to War of Resistance against Japanese Aggression, daliang town had the custom of "Fish Lantern Festival". Every autumn, choose a crisp autumn night or Lantern Festival to hold a parade. Folk fund-raising, organize the fish lamp association to be responsible for the preparation.
